Output d5c2ecd6966c5e8181ff0aebbc95c7517b879a98ef6803ae81becb00f7d1d36d:1

value
19704245
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7add3e002f86a279ebcb97531b61700e6ce51c4f OP_EQUAL
address
3CtfQ89CAinzajmYrkB9hX5t9knQw43FcZ
transaction
d5c2ecd6966c5e8181ff0aebbc95c7517b879a98ef6803ae81becb00f7d1d36d
spent
true